Austwell, Texas

Austwell (/ˈɔːswɛl/ AW-swel) is a city in northeastern Refugio County, Texas, United States.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 0.4 sq mi (1.0 km2), all land.

Approximately 8 miles (13 km) south of Austwell is the Aransas National Wildlife Refuge, an important preserve for the whooping crane.

The climate in this area is characterized by hot, humid summers and generally mild to cool winters.

[9] At the 2010 census, there were 147 people in 71 households, including 47 families, in the city.

The racial makeup of the city was 91.67% White, 1.56% African American, 6.77% from other races.

About 32.0% of families and 33.5% of the population were below the poverty line, including 44.4% of those under the age of eighteen and 33.3% of those sixty five or over.
